![]() If you choose to quit smoking, you should wait at least six weeks from your last cigarette before undergoing the Brazilian Buttocks Augmentation. ![]() This happens because the nicotine in cigarette smoke (and non-cigarette products as well) prevents the fat cells from getting enough oxygen to survive. Smokers typically lose almost all of their injected fat volume. This means that you need to be healthy, have sufficient body fat, abstain from anything that can thin your blood, abstain from smoking, and abstain from dieting for the first three months after surgery.Ĭigarette smoking will lead to poor results. Since the Brazilian Buttocks Augmentation is a fusion of two procedures – Lipo and Fat Injections – people seeking this procedure need to be good prospects for both of these procedures.
